Preventive Medicine Residency Program
Announcement Number:
HRSA-18-008
Bureau/Office:
Bureau of Health Workforce
Date(s) to Apply:
11/09/2017
to
01/26/2018
Estimated Award Date:
05/01/2018
What is the program?
This program increases the number and quality of preventive medicine residents and physicians. This will support access to preventive medicine to improve the health of communities.
Are you eligible?
Entities eligible to apply for this grant program are:
- an accredited school of public health or school of medicine or osteopathic medicine;
- an accredited public or private nonprofit hospital;
- a state, local or tribal health department; or
- a consortium of two or more eligible entities as described above.
Preventive medicine residency programs must be accredited by ACGME or the AOA. You must submit an official letter from the appropriate accrediting body to us with the application. It must include the approved accreditation status of the program with the beginning and ending dates of the current accreditation.
